Two killed in fatal crash - Victoria Highway

Police

A section of the Victoria Highway, approximately four kilometres past the Binjari turnoff, remains closed after a two person fatal crash overnight.

Sergeant Mark Casey from the Major Crash Investigation Section said the crash was reported to Police at 10:40 pm and members from Katherine, NT Emergency Services and St John Ambulance immediately attended the scene.

"Initial investigations suggest that a 4WD vehicle towing a trailer has attempted to avoid a female pedestrian on the road, but the female was struck and killed instantly.

"The 4WD then lost control and impacted with a stationary vehicle, before colliding with another female pedestrian, who was also killed instantly.

"A male was taken to the Katherine Hospital as a result of injuries sustained.

"A section of the Victoria Highway will remain closed until further notice while investigations continue," said Sergeant Casey.

Members from the Major Crash Investigation Section the Northern Traffic Command are continuing with investigations, there is no further information at this time.

The Territory road toll now stands at three compared to zero for the same period last year.
